Summary:
Reporting to the Director of Customer Success, the Sr. Customer Success Manager will play a vital role in ensuring our clients thrive with our platform. You'll manage a portfolio of assigned accounts, focusing on building strong relationships, driving adoption, and ultimately, exceeding their expectations.
What You Will Do:
- Drive client outcomes by understanding client goals and analyzing data metrics to identify areas for improvement and proactively recommend solutions to increase adoption and satisfaction.
- Become a product expert and gain a deep understanding of our platform and its functionalities to provide expert guidance and support.
- Foster strategic partnerships and collaborate closely with Enterprise Account Managers, Product, and Engineering teams to ensure seamless client experiences.
- Build long-term relationships through conducting regular check-ins with clients, actively listening to their needs, and proactively addressing their challenges.
- Resolve inquiries and escalations by responding promptly and effectively to client requests, leveraging internal resources and processes when needed.
